Abstract
The effect of small doping additions (ten metal cations) on the structural characteristics of the sol-gel-synthesized silicas was evaluated by the SAXS method. Doping with cobalt, cerium, and silver cations led to separation of metal compounds as single phases. All the tested cations affected the radius of gyration and the fractal dimension of the resultant silicas.
